Janet Mensah rockets past Grace Obour to win women’s 200m final

Janet Mensah left to the final 10 meters to steal the show as she overtook Grace Obour to win the women’s 200m final race at the LOC Invitational Championship at the Cape Coast Sports Stadium on Friday morning.

Mensah recorded a time of 24.229 seconds to win over Obour who was clearly outgased at the last moments of the race.

Ethel Amissah placed third after clocking 25.266 seconds.
